A little lean

8/29/2015

0 Comments

 
Picture

"Nah, " I told myself. "A little lean is probably a good thing. Rain will run right off. "

I noticed my homemade firewood rack wasn't quite level before I spent part of the afternoon stacking half a cord of split logs in it. It was the second of two identical racks beside the steps outside the door that I filled up, dreaming with every stick of the glorious fires to come as winter settles in.

Finally evening tapped me on the shoulder and persuaded me to pour a glass of wine and stoke up a cigar.

As Mary and I lounged contentedly in the palace, planning supper and dreaming of the hot tub to follow we were startled by an earthquake - or a very close thunder boom. Or maybe a train derailment somewhere up the line.

In a matter of seconds our puzzled expressions transformed into an "ah" moment as we hustled over to check the stash.

And there was the proof that a little lean to an 8' X 5' rack of firewood does too make a difference.

Gardening and pancakes

8/3/2015

0 Comments

 
Picture
Tomato luck isn't with me this year. Our little garden at camp has started producing a few on the vine, but I think we'll be ripening most of them on the kitchen counter after frost hits. They are late, and not bountiful.

Lettuce, chard, and zucchinis... wonderful year for them. We're eating green these days and happy about it. (I have a little formula that allows me to dish up some ice cream after a garden salad).

Sioux Lookout has almost 6000 happy fingers today. Our Rotary club served 600 pancake breakfasts this morning. I poured coffee at the tables for most of the diners and by closing time at 11 o'clock we had only a handful of scalded digits. I'm hoping the Tim Horton's scouts were in the house. I may have a bright retirement future as a coffee pourer.

The weekend of our disconnect

8/3/2015

0 Comments

 
Picture
Picture
Picture
We were without cell/Internet at camp all weekend. Hardly the end of the world, but a little bit inconvenient - especially if Publishers Clearing House was trying to call us for delivery of a million bucks.

It's funny how we forget... Saturday morning we wondered what the weather would be. Normally I'd just check the forecast using my cell phone. Part way through the afternoon - hours later - I had a brilliant idea. "Hey, why don't we turn the radio on and listen for the forecast..." That's a duh moment.

We fired up the table on the Palace deck for the first time. The evening was cool enough for pleasure of the heat, and the full moon peeking through the clouds of our southern sky was a treat.

I've been a good boy, more or less, so treated myself Saturday night to barbequed tenderloin and baby potatoes served in a cast iron sizzler. That was pretty special. I'm either going to behave myself again soon so I can do it another time, or just cheat and do it anyway.
